St. Patrick’s Day Food: Rainbow Sangria

February 17, 2014   |   Leave a Comment

St. Patrick’s Day wouldn’t be quite the same with out rainbows and alcohol. Right? So, I thought I would combine the two together and make a St. Patrick’s day Rainbow Sangria with my favorite wine and colorful fruit.

Rainbow Sangria sounded like a great St. Patrick’s Day drink but it would also be delicious and refreshing during the summer months too.  You could also make this without alcohol and use Sprite or 7-up as a kids version of the drink.  Rainbow Sangria would go well at a tie dye birthday party or even a baby shower, how fun would that be?

St. Patrick’s Day is right around the corner and I don’t drink beer so making a festive drink like this will make the holiday fun!

Rainbow Sangria Ingredients

  • 1 Bottle of Mirassou Moscato wine
  • 1 Bottle of Seltzer water
  • 1 Cup of Red Grapes
  • 1 Cup of Green Grapes
  • 1 Cup of Pineapple
  • 1 Cup of Mandarin Oranges
  • 1 Cup of Strawberries or Raspberries

Instructions

Step 1 – Layer the fruit in a pitcher or individual glasses to create a rainbow look.

Step 2 – Fill half of the glass or pitcher up with Mirassou Moscato

Step 3 – Fill up the rest of the glass or pitcher with the Seltzer Water

You can adjust this to your tastes, using all Moscato would work well too or if you don’t have seltzer water you can use Sprite or a similar soda in place.  This would give it different flavor though, you would taste less of the wine and fruit.
